Password Reset Functionality (Agency Admin)
The Password Reset feature is designed for the Agency Admin role, offering a critical tool for assisting external users with their login credentials. This feature is not available to other system roles.
Key Capabilities:
Scope of Access: Agency Admin can reset passwords and set usernames for internal and external users, addressing issues with credential creation or reset.
User Interface: A dedicated "Manage User" screen includes:
User Search Filter: Allows searching for users to update their details.
User Listing: Displays internal and external users with access, enabling credential management.
MFA Management: Includes an MFA reset filter to enhance security.
Username/Password Management:
Agency Admins can set new passwords and usernames, automatically deleting old credentials to ensure secure access with updated information.
Practical Use Case:
When external users face difficulties setting passwords, Agency Admins can swiftly manage and share new credentials securely, enhancing both user experience and system security.
Change Expense Authoriser
The Change Expense Authoriser feature enables the update of the expense authoriser based on assignment changes, even after submission.
Key Features:
Update Authoriser: The expense authoriser can be updated when the expense is in Draft or Awaiting Authorisation status.
New Client User Assignment: A new client user added to the assignment settings will be reflected as the authoriser for any applicable expenses.
This feature ensures that expense authorisation remains accurate and up-to-date.
Invoice Report Updates
New Job Title Column: A new Job Title column has been added to the Sales Ledger Report, displaying data from the assignment and timesheet for better visibility.
Consolidated Sales Ledger Report Enhancements:
Updated Column Display: The column is now showing the first consultant label created in the assignment.
When the Group by client or contractor option is selected, invoices are grouped by the first assignment created, including the first consultant label.
VAT Rounding Enhancement (Remittance)
The VAT rounding issue between remittance and reports/PDFs has been addressed. VAT is now rounded per line item and then summed, ensuring consistency across documents. This applies even when a PEO uplift is involved.
Additional Features
When rejecting or deleting a timesheet any associated Purchase Order will be unlinked as to not utilise the Purchase Order amounts.
Agency Admin can now delete/reject timesheets in all statuses with linked Purchase Orders, automatically adjusting the Purchase Order accordingly.
A filter for unmapped expenses from timesheets has been added to enable the Agency Users easier visibility on which expenses are yet to be submitted against a timesheet.
The due date is now included in the invoice mail based on the payment terms within the Client settings.
